Find Japanese Restaurants
Near: Prim
- Drasco Japanese Restaurants
- Edgemont Japanese Restaurants
- Higden Japanese Restaurants
- Ida Japanese Restaurants
- Marcella Japanese Restaurants
- Tumbling Shoals Japanese Restaurants
- Concord Japanese Restaurants
- Fairfield Bay Japanese Restaurants
- Pleasant Grove Japanese Restaurants
- Heber Springs Japanese Restaurants